Bought a Sony Xperia M c1905 off a friend as a temporary phone as need a mobile at all times for my line of work.

However. Upon receipt and advice that it had never been used (it did arrive still in box), I switched it on and realised it required a good charge as you would. I turned it off and left it to fully charge. When I switched it back on it vibrated as usual, followed by 'SONY' initial screen then the normal 'XPERIA' logo. After this a mixed ribbon-type, sort of flames design, as fire graphic moves from left screen to right as if part of the display boot-up process. It is like a screen saver-type graphic, a mixture of purple, orange, blue etc colours.

The problem is that it just keeps repeating or looping this graphic left to right, L - R, L -R...and so forth. It's clearly jammed and not moving on to home screen as you would expect without any issues. I used Sony PC Companion to reinstall Android, this completed successfully and the boot process commenced, aforementioned 'flames' graphic appeared, but, then disappeared after 10 secs and the 'setup' screen arrived and so on. Perfect. Until...it ran out of battery again and died, now I'm back to square one. PLEASE HELP I'm going cray here...
